How much does it cost to rent a home in Hall County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hall County 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,807 | $1,200 | $5,500 |
| Hall County 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,080 | $1,170 | $3,500 |
| Hall County 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,653 | $1,850 | $5,900 |
| Hall County 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,477 | $2,440 | $10,000+ |
| Hall County 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,990 | $4,990 | $4,990 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Hall County
What type of rentals are currently available in Hall County?
There are currently 188 Apartments for Rent in Hall County, GA with pricing that ranges from $659 to $21,630. There are also 250 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Hall County ranging from $870 to $13,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Hall County?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Hall County ranges from $870 to $13,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,754.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Hall County?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Hall County range from $1,075 to $5,800,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,170 to $3,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,850 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,395.
